Answer: There are two main types of grants: discretionary and mandatory. Discretionary grants permit the agency to exercise judgment in selecting recipients through a competitive grant process. Mandatory grants are required to be awarded if the recipients meet certain predetermined conditions.
The National Center for Family Philanthropy3 defines discretionary grants, more simply, as those made at the discretion of individual trustees or other authorized individuals, without the standard approval process and/or review by the full board.
Where does the money come from? The two primary sources of grant money are public and private funds. Public funds are obtained from governmental units, such as federal, state, and local agencies.

Discretionary grants awarded to students based on a competitive process. Formulaic grants awarded to all students who meet set criteria without an application process. Grants based on financial need.
The most common non-competitive opportunities offered by federal agencies are formula grants, which distribute funds to every recipient in a group (such as all 50 states) to accomplish the same purpose. These may also be known as federal-aid funds or formula funds.
